Output 89e253d42c96b9a9967133dbfe100ec16f669d2b3dca7c6c97b76e7a0fe74328:0

value
25576168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c35dadaa8f7978a702d5eba9be59afda55bb17 OP_EQUAL
address
39se6sy14mJ8KefatZCs8Wos5UzViseuLW
transaction
89e253d42c96b9a9967133dbfe100ec16f669d2b3dca7c6c97b76e7a0fe74328
spent
true